Understanding Owner's vs Lender's Title Insurance
Quick, Definitive Answer
Owner's title insurance and lender's title insurance serve different purposes but are both integral in real estate transactions. Lender's title insurance is mandatory and protects the lender against any title defects that could affect their loan. This insurance is typically included in the closing costs and remains in effect until the loan is paid off. On the other hand, owner's title insurance is optional but highly recommended. It safeguards the homeowner from potential title issues that could arise after the purchase, such as liens, encumbrances, or fraudulent claims. This insurance is purchased with a one-time premium and lasts as long as you own the property. In Milan, where property values can fluctuate, having this protection is especially important. How Title Insurance Works in Milan, Michigan
Key Details and Process Steps
The process of obtaining title insurance involves a thorough examination of the property's title history. This includes a detailed search of public records to identify any existing issues that could affect ownership. For lender's insurance, the cost is typically included in your closing fees. Owner's insurance, though optional, is a wise investment given the potential risks. Here are the steps involved:
- Title Search: A comprehensive review of public records to uncover any potential issues.
- Title Examination: Analyzing the findings to assess risks.
- Issuance of Insurance: Once the title is deemed clear, the insurance policy is issued.

Common Mistakes and Expert Tips
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is assuming that lender's title insurance is sufficient to protect your interests. This insurance only covers the lender, not the homeowner. Another pitfall is neglecting to review the title report thoroughly. Overlooking this step can lead to unexpected surprises later. Lastly, some buyers skip owner's insurance to save on upfront costs, not realizing the long-term protection it offers.
